Docupoint Announces 2011 Release of DrawingSearcher

Provides full text search capabilities throughout AutoCAD drawing files.

Docupoint has announced the availability of the newest release of DrawingSearcher, version 2011. DrawingSearcher 2011 is compatible with AutoCAD 2011 and all prior versions of AutoCAD. Also included in the new release are enhanced Administrator Tools.

One key feature of DrawingSearcher is that it is  web-browser based, allowing any user within an organization to search and find AutoCAD drawings. Users do not even need AutoCAD on their computer to search and view AutoCAD drawings, says Brad Bishop of Docupoint. As a true document management tool, it makes it easy for companies and organizations to justify the purchase of DrawingSearcher.

DrawingSearcher is installed on a computer server behind a firewall. Automatically generated preview images then make it possible to identify the drawing(s) of interest from the search results via preview images that open a generated DWF file for viewing. DrawingSearchers SmartZoom feature allows users to jump around inside drawings to see each instance of the search results, zoomed and centered appropriately.

DrawingSearcher is available in two editions:
* Gold  allows users to search AutoCAD drawings and other related documents created on Microsoft Office software including Word/Excel/Powerpoint/etc. and Adobe PDF files and Scanned files stored in TIFF or CALS format.
* Silver  allows users to search only AutoCAD drawings.

The DrawingSearcher server application runs on Microsoft Windows 7, Vista, XP or Windows 2003 Servers. Client computers require Internet Explorer 6.0 (or higher) and the free Autodesk Design Review application for collaboration and mark-up.
